This is a great website

for running, especially if you haven’t done it in awhile. I hadn’t run in over 14 years and my parents recommended www.coolrunning.com
They have a program called, “From Couch Potato to 5K in 9 Weeks.” I did it in 8 weeks. I don’t know if you’re interested or not, but it really helped me organize my workouts. Good luck and happy trails!
